DESCRIPTION:Nat Reeves brings his sextet to The Side Door\, the same all-star group from his new album Now in Time. For over 40 years\, Nat Reeves has been one of the most respected bassists in jazz. Early in his career he performed with Jackie McLean\, Benny Golson\, Donald Byrd\, Art Taylor\, Mulgrew Miller\, Kenny Kirkland\, and Kenny Drew. He became a longtime member of Kenny Garrett’s group beginning in 1994\, and has worked and recorded with Pharoah Sanders\, George Coleman\, Harold Mabern\, George Cables\, and Joe Farnsworth\, among many others. He has released three albums as a leader\, State of Emergency\, Blue Ridge\, and now Now in Time\, released April 17\, 2026 on Cellar Live. \nNow in Time brings together an extraordinary lineup spanning multiple generations of jazz\, twelve tracks running just over an hour that move comfortably between Reeves’ own original compositions and a thoughtful selection of standards\, including “On Green Dolphin Street\,” “Alice in Wonderland\,” and a tribute to Marvin Gaye with “The Creator Has a Master Plan.” Throughout the record\, Reeves’ bass acts as a quiet narrator\, steering the music’s direction with the kind of unhurried confidence that comes from four decades on the bandstand. DESCRIPTION:Nearly sixty years after he moved to the United States from Kingston\, Jamaica\, his hometown\, GRAMMY® nominated pianist Monty Alexander is an American classic\, touring the world relentlessly with various projects\, delighting a global audience drawn to his vibrant personality and soulful message. A perennial favorite at Jazz festivals and venues worldwide and at the Montreux Jazz Festival where he has appeared 23 times since 1976\, his spirited conception is one informed by the timeless verities: endless melody-making\, effervescent grooves\, sophisticated voicings\, a romantic spirit\, and a consistent predisposition. \nIn the course of any given performance\, Alexander applies those aesthetics to a repertoire spanning a broad range of jazz and Jamaican musical expressions—the American songbook and the blues\, gospel and bebop\, calypso and reggae. DESCRIPTION:Joe Alterman returns to Eddie’s Attic for one night only!!! \nAtlanta native Joe Alterman expresses a certain upbeat naivete\, with a broad smile and bright eyes that make you feel welcome. One would not guess that this is a man hailed by greats; Ramsey Lewis describes his piano playing as ‘a joy to behold’\, Les McCann states ‘As a man and musician he is already a giant’.
